Hug Point Falls is a 15-foot waterfall that gently cascades down a sandstone drop-off along the Oregon Coast.
Rangel Alvarado/Google Local
The terrain of this area is rocky and rugged; and over time, the waves have created several explorable caves, too.

What makes this waterfall even more unique is that viewing is limited by the ocean tides.
Verdance/Flickr
The falls can only be safely accessed at low tide. During this time, you’ll also discover tide pools teeming with ocean treasures – sea anemones, starfish, muscles, and even crabs!
